A dangerous and notorious Mongrel Mob member with an extensive criminal history was arrested this morning in Flaxmere.
The 45-year-old was on the run from Waitakere Police after he breached his parole conditions.
Police said Andre Tipi Rangi Wiremu Schudder was apprehended at a residence on Dundee Drive about 8.00am after information from the public led them to the address.
Schudder normally lives in the Auckland area, but has strong family connections to Hawke's Bay and was reportedly in the region during the past few months.
There were several warrants for his return to prison, police said.
